What Would a Suprapubic Catheter Indwelling for 4 Years Be Like? A Case Report
Kun-Ru Yang1, Shui-Qing Wu1, Ke-Qin Zhou1
1Department of Urinary Surgery, The Second Xiangya Hospital, Central South University, Changsha, Hunan, China.
Abstract:
A 35-year-old male of 165 cm height and weight of 65 kg, had a suprapubic catheter indwelling for 4 years without replacement for urethral stricture. The catheter became gradually obstructed, and urine leaked out around the suprapubic catheter. A lumbar abdominal distension, an inferior abdominal mass and renal failure prompted him to seek medical attention in our hospital in September 2018. This clinical case is hereby presented from 3 aspects of imaging, lab examination, and operation.
